## Authentication

Portionly (the recipe-scaling calculator) doesn't do anything exotic here — one static key, sent as a bearer token to the Ladleworks internal API. Security review notes: the key is read-only, scoped to unit-conversion lookups, and can't touch user data. It rotates every 60 days via the Ladleworks rotation job. Yes, we know static keys aren't ideal; migration to short-lived tokens is tracked separately. The current key appears below.

gateway credential: kto3_qfe

## v4.7 — Changed defaults

The Verdanthaus greenhouse controller now recalibrates humidity sensors every six hours instead of every twenty-four, following the drift incidents in the Millbrae pilot houses. The drift alarm threshold also tightened from 8% to 5% deviation. Expect more recalibration log lines but fewer false climate alerts overnight. The updated defaults the controller ships with are listed directly below.

service settings:
OLIATH_HOST=oliath.tolvaqlabs.internal
OLIATH_PORT=6379

Fan-out backpressure for the Quillet notifier: when the queue depth crosses the soft limit, the dispatcher sheds low-priority pushes and batches the rest at 500ms intervals. Reviewer should confirm the shed counter is exported and that retries respect the jitter window. Once merged, the release artifact gets re-signed by the pipeline, which expects the deploy key shown below.

deploy key for bawep-yawif: bky6_GQhaSt